The College of Electrical Training, based in Perth, Western Australia, is looking for qualified instructors to help deliver courses and course material to students studying at our colleges. CET is a Registered Training business unit of ECA WA.
As an employee of The Electrical and Communications Association of Western Australia, you’ll be a part of a charitable organisation which supports and advances the interests of the electrical, electronic, communications, instrumentation, automation, robotics, refrigeration, renewable energy, and air conditioning industries in Western Australia.
For this role, you will need to be a qualified Electrician and hold, or be working toward a Certificate in Training and Assessment or the latest equivalent qualification, and be willing to obtain a Working with Children Check.
